A Slow, Sweet Start



If you’ve never experienced a newborn session before, here’s the truth:


They’re not rushed.


They’re not perfectly posed.


And they definitely don’t go exactly as planned.


And that’s the magic of it.


Baby needed to be fed (twice ), cuddled, and comforted. Instead of seeing that as a pause in the session, I leaned into it.


Because those are the moments that matter.


Dad holding baby close.


Mom gently soothing.


The quiet in-between moments that tell the real story of those first days at home.

The Beauty of In-Home Sessions



There’s something so special about in-home newborn sessions.


They’re slow.


They’re gentle.


They leave space for real moments to unfold naturally.


This session was such a beautiful reminder that it’s not about creating perfect images…


It’s about capturing connection.



The way they held their baby.


The quiet moments in between feedings.


The love that filled every moment we documented.


And that’s what makes these sessions so meaningful —


Just being together, exactly as you are.
